Easy Access To Your Loan Problems - Online Debt Consolidation Debt consolidation is a tool by which a person who has taken loans from different creditors can make that into one from one creditor.
An example of how to use debt consolidation will make the matter more clear suppose you are a person who has taken loan from creditor A at 10% p.a., another loan from creditor B at 12% p.a. and a third loan from creditor C at 11% p.a. What debt consolidation would do is that it will accumulate all these loans and convert them into one single loan from a different creditor.
Debt consolidation is taken by people for many reasons. The primary ones are:
It is difficult to keep track of all the loans that we have taken and hence, making repayments is also tough. If the repayments are not made the credit keeps on increasing and interest rate increasing so debt consolidation eliminates that problem.
Local creditors may not be that understanding and they may keep embarrassing you regarding the loan.
The new creditor of yours will give you loan terms that are better than what you currently have which would include low interest rates for longer duration and other fringe benefits.
